Leatherhead Food Research provides expertise and support to the global food and beverage sector. We provide practical solutions that cover all stages of a product’s lifecycle from consumer insight, ingredient innovation to food safety consultancy and global regulatory advice.

The Regulatory Department provides members and clients with an unparalleled global food and beverage regulatory advisory service covering more than 160 countries. Our services include assessing the legal compliance of all aspects of their products. Day in the life

As regulatory analyst, you will have the opportunity to employ and improve your critical and analytical skills on one or more projects, simultaneously expanding your knowledge of food and beverage regulatory affairs. Projects often have tight deadlines, therefore you will be required to multitask, maintaining excellent quality, consistency and accuracy on the reports. You will enjoy a variety of tasks such as artworks and formulations checks, food and beverage compliance assessments, development of a regulatory framework for products coming to a new market, among others.

In addition you will attend internal regulatory meetings which will give you exposure to the wider challenges of the industry.
